Why do people use laxatives to lose weight? What does it do?


Answers: They do it because they think it helps them lose weight, but it doesn't. Laxatives affect the large intestine, but all of the calories and nutrients we eat are absorbed in the small intestine. By the time the laxative works, all the calories have already been absorbed.

This is a section of the book called, "Weight Loss That Lasts" by James M. Rippe, M.D.: PLEASE READ IT ALL, I know it's long!
"The way carbohydrates are stores and processed in the body is different from that for fats. Insulin plays an important role in the metabolism of carbohydrates. The body produces insulin in a finely regulated way to manage the inflow of blood sugar after eating. Carbohydrates act like a sponge in the body. Every gram of carbohydrate that is stored in the body as glycogen, a type of carb the body uses to meet short term energy needs, holds in to an additional 3 GRAMS OF WATER. When the body uses up glycogen, it also releases water and extra weight. This phenomenon creates the ILLUSION of a quick loss of body fat. Carbohydrates are essential. Carbohydrates in the form of a sugar called glucose are the preferred source of energy by the body. This conversion process is a fundamental part of the digestion and metabolism of food. For some parts of the body, including the brain, glucose is the only fuel source that can be used to meet energy needs. The need for glucose is so important to our survival that, when deprived of carbohydrates, the body will take extreme metabolic actions to manufacture the glucose that it needs. It has systems in place that, if required, can take the protein out of muscle, strip off the nitrogen bits that make it a protein, and convert the rest to glucose. Over time this process is quite detrimental, potentially resulting in a buildup of nitrogen that leads to the development of kidney stones or gout. The body will sacrifice MUSCLE for glucose in order to survive. *****Based on a complete review of the human need for glucose, the Institute of Medicine has set the Recommended Daily Allowance for carbohydrates at a minimum of 130 grams per day. Following an extreme diet that restricts carbs to less than 130 grams per day means that the body must resort to survival systems to make its own glucose, usually at the cost of muscle, to meet its minimal needs. Many extreme low-carb diets require that you eat no more than 20 grams of carbs per day. To put that into perspective, a cup of milk has 12 grams of carbs, a slice of regular bread has 15, and a large apple has 20 grams. In addition to being the body's preferred source of energy, foods rich in carbs contain several ESSENTIAL nutrients that are important for nutritional health and disease prevention. Beyond meeting basic nutritional needs, making food choices that include a wide variety of wholesome carbohydrate rich foods has consistently been shown to lead to a reduced risk of many chronic diseases such as high blood pressure, kidney disease, osteoporosis, and several forms of cancer"*****

Too much fiber?

Yesturday I had a bowl of cereal, alot of coffee with splenda, alot of water, some pretzels, animal crakers, and a HHHHHHHHHHUUUUUUUUUUGGGGGGGGGGGGEEEEEEEE... salad with fat free italian dressing. No i am not trying to lose weight it is just my food preference. Anyways, by about seven thirty that night I had really really bad stomach cramps. Could this have anything to do with my diet? (I also exercised that morning for about 45 minutes.)
Answers: I doubt it had to do with your fiber, it doesn't even look like you ate 25 grams, the recommended daily value for a female under 50. The only things you ate with fiber are the cereal and salad. Check into the coffee, splenda, and dressing. Coffee can easily upset people's stomachs, splenda isn't perfectly natural, and salad dressing has an ingredient (xanthan gum) that causes cramping.
The Recommended amount of fiber for Americans is 25-38 grams. Most can not consume this amount because they normally don't. The body must get used to fiber gradually. Also, there are two types of fiber, Soluble and Insoluble. Soluble will dissolve in water and provide more health benefits as opposed to Insoluble which absorbs water and increases fecal bulk. The Insoluble fiber is most likely what hurt your stomach.

What kind of beans has the most amount of protein in it?


Answers: Most beans yield the same amount of protein per gram. Beans alone are a good source of protein but are not a complete source of protein. This means that they do not have all nine essential amino acids in them. Beans should be consumed with grains to ensure all nine essential amino acids are consumed.

Cardio vs. Strength training?

If I am doing both in the same day, is it beneficial to do one before the other?

Short answer: Strength training.

Strength training is anaerobic and requires blood sugar. If you're lifting heavy, or for an extended period of time (more than 30 minutes), you want to ensure you have a good reserve. A cardio session will likely deplete this, and make your lifting less productive.

If you're doing very intense cardio, you'll also need sugars, or your body will start burning up your muscles for fuel. You may want to have a protein supplement or some gatorade to help prevent this.

Can anyone explain Bench Press?

Why does incline target upper pecs, and decline target lower pecs? Can you explain the physics of it to me?
Answers: The upper and lower pecs are two seperate heads of the pectoralis major. As the angle of your upper arm changes, the muscle is simply recruited differently.

There are three variants of the bench press: incline, flat, and decline. You're progressively stronger on each of these because the movements are less dependent on the shoulder, and more dependent on the lower, larger head of pecs.
